On average across the year,
yes, the U.S. Virgin Islands is hotter than
Weymouth, Massachusetts
.
the U.S. Virgin Islands has an average temperature of 28°C/82°F and Weymouth, Massachusetts has an average temperature of 11°C/52°F.
the U.S. Virgin Islands's hottest month is June, with an average maximum temperature of 32°C/90°F, which is hotter than Weymouth, Massachusetts's hottest month (July, with an average maximum temperature of 29°C/84°F).
On average across the year, no, the U.S. Virgin Islands is not colder than Weymouth, Massachusetts . the U.S. Virgin Islands has an average minimum temperature of 25°C/77°F and Weymouth, Massachusetts has an average minimum temperature of 6°C/43°F.
On average across the year,
no, the U.S. Virgin Islands has less rain than
Weymouth, Massachusetts. the U.S. Virgin Islands has an average annual rainfall of 1018mm and Weymouth, Massachusetts has an average annual rainfall of 1446mm.
the U.S. Virgin Islands's wettest month is November, with an average monthly rainfall of 154mm, which is drier than Weymouth, Massachusetts's wettest month (October, with an average monthly rainfall of 167mm).
